What is Sciatica?

Sciatica is pain that radiates along the pathway of the sciatic nerve, the longest and largest nerve in the human bodyThis nerve originates from nerve roots in the lumbar and sacral spine, specifically the L4, L5, S1, S2, and S3 levels.

Understanding sciatica requires recognizing an important distinction: may sciatica is technically a symptom rather than a diagnosisIt describes the experience of pain along the sciatic nerve distribution, not the underlying cause creating that pain. typically Sciatica typically affects only one side of the body. The pain intensity can range from a mild ache to severe, debilitating discomfort that makes it difficult to stand, walk, or even sleep.

Some patients describe the sensation as burning, shooting, or electric-like. Others experience it as a deep, constant ache. The sciatic nerve’s length and the fact that it travels through multiple structures makes it vulnerable to compression or irritation at various points along its pathway.

Common Causes of Sciatica

Several conditions can trigger sciatic nerve irritation, each requiring a slightly different treatment approach:

  • Herniated discs: A herniated lumbar disc is the most common cause of sciatica accounting for approximately 90% of sciatica cases. When the soft inner material of a disc pushes through its outer layer, it can press directly on the nerve roots that form the sciatic nerve.
  • Piriformis syndrome: This occurs when the piriformis muscle in the buttock becomes tight or spasms, causing pain similar to true sciatica but originating from muscle compression rather than spinal nerve root involvement.
  • Spinal stenosis: Narrowing of the spinal canal in the lower back can compress the nerve roots before they exit to form the sciatic nerve, creating sciatic symptoms.
  • Spondylolisthesis: When one vertebra slips forward over another, it can pinch the sciatic nerve roots as they exit the spine.
  • Pregnancy-related changes: The weight and position of a growing baby can put pressure on the sciatic nerve, though this typically resolves after delivery.

What is Lumbar Radiculopathy?

Lumbar radiculopathy represents a broader category than sciatica. It’s defined as compression, irritation, or inflammation of one or more nerve roots in the lumbar spine.

Unlike sciatica, which is a symptom, lumbar radiculopathy is a medical diagnosis based on specific nerve root involvement. The lumbar spine contains five vertebrae (L1 through L5), each with nerve roots that exit on both sides. Below that, the sacral spine adds the S1, S2, and S3 nerve roots.

Lumbar radiculopathy can affect any of these nerve roots, and each creates a distinct pattern of symptoms based on where that particular nerve travels in the body. Here’s where the relationship between sciatica and lumbar radiculopathy becomes clear: generally the sciatic nerve is specifically formed from the L4, L5, S1, S2, and S3 nerve roots.

This means sciatica is actually a specific type of lumbosacral radiculopathy. However, not all lumbar radiculopathy is sciatica. For example, if only the L3 nerve root is compressed, you might experience pain radiating down the front of your thigh, but this wouldn’t be considered sciatica because it doesn’t involve the sciatic nerve pathway.

Understanding this distinction helps explain why two patients with “lumbar radiculopathy” might experience very different symptoms depending on which specific nerve roots are affected. Common Causes of Lumbar Radiculopathy

Lumbar radiculopathy results from various structural changes in the spine that compress or irritate nerve roots:

  • Herniated discs: Disc material pressing directly on a nerve root as it exits the spinal canal
  • Spinal stenosis: Narrowing of the central spinal canal affects approximately 8-11% of the population experiencing lumbar spine symptoms
  • Foraminal stenosis: Narrowing of the small openings where nerve roots exit the spine, often due to degenerative changes
  • Facet joint arthritis and bone spurs: Facet joint osteoarthritis can create bone spurs that encroach on the neuroforamina, progressively compressing the nerve
  • Spondylolisthesis: Vertebral misalignment that pinches nerve roots between displaced bones
  • Degenerative disc disease: As discs lose height over time, the space available for nerve roots diminishes, potentially causing compression

Key Differences Between Sciatica and Lumbar Radiculopathy

Understanding the distinctions between these two terms helps clarify what you’re experiencing and guides appropriate treatment:

Scope: Sciatica is specific to pain involving the sciatic nerve pathway, while lumbar radiculopathy encompasses compression of any lumbar or sacral nerve root.

Classification: Sciatica describes a symptom—the experience of pain along the sciatic nerve. Lumbar radiculopathy is a diagnostic condition identifying which nerve root is affected and why.

Nerve involvement: may Sciatica involves the L4, L5, S1, S2, and S3 nerve roots that combine to form the sciatic nerve. generally Lumbar radiculopathy can involve any nerve root from L1 through S1, creating different symptom patterns depending on the level affected.

Pain pattern: Sciatica typically causes pain running from the buttock down the back or side of the leg, potentially reaching the foot. Other forms of lumbar radiculopathy vary by the affected nerve root. For instance, L5 radiculopathy may cause lateral leg pain and foot drop, while L3 radiculopathy creates anterior thigh pain.

Terminology: All sciatica represents lumbosacral radiculopathy, but not all lumbar radiculopathy qualifies as sciatica. This nested relationship is key to understanding your diagnosis.

Symptoms: What You Might Experience

Both sciatica and lumbar radiculopathy share overlapping symptoms, but the specific pattern can help identify which nerve roots are involved.

Sciatica symptoms typically include pain radiating from the lower back through the buttock and down the back of the leg to the foot. You might experience numbness or tingling along the same pathway, and some patients report weakness in the affected leg. The pain often worsens with prolonged sitting, standing, or certain movements like bending or twisting.

Lumbar radiculopathy symptoms depend on which specific nerve root is affected. L5 radiculopathy commonly causes foot drop and weakness in ankle dorsiflexion. S1 radiculopathy may cause weakness in plantar flexion. Upper lumbar radiculopathy (L2-L3) typically creates pain in the anterior thigh and may affect hip flexion strength.

Both conditions typically affect one side of the body, though bilateral symptoms can occur in severe cases of central stenosis. Symptoms often fluctuate based on position and activity, with many patients finding relief by lying down or avoiding certain movements that increase nerve compression.

How Dallas Spine Specialists Diagnose These Conditions

Accurate diagnosis requires a comprehensive evaluation combining several assessment methods.

Your spine specialist begins with a detailed history and physical examination, asking about your symptoms, their onset, what makes them better or worse, and how they affect your daily activities. This conversation provides crucial clues about the underlying cause.

Neurological testing assesses sensation, strength, and reflexes in specific distributions. By testing which areas are weak, numb, or have altered reflexes, your physician can identify which nerve roots are likely affected. For example, an absent ankle reflex suggests S1 involvement, while weakness lifting the big toe points toward L5.

Imaging studies visualize the structural problem. MRI is the gold standard for identifying disc herniations and nerve compression with sensitivity ranging from 90-95% for detecting herniated discs. CT scans excel at showing bony changes, while X-rays assess alignment and stability.

Electrodiagnostic studies including EMG and nerve conduction studies can confirm which specific nerve root is affected. These tests help differentiate between radiculopathy and other conditions like peripheral neuropathy.

Treatment Options for Sciatica and Lumbar Radiculopathy

Fortunately, most cases of sciatica and lumbar radiculopathy respond well to conservative treatment. Conservative approaches including physical therapy, anti-inflammatory medications, and activity modification provide symptom relief in a significant majority of acute sciatica cases approximately 80-90% within 6-12 weeks.

Treatment typically follows a stepwise approach, beginning with conservative measures and progressing to interventional or surgical options only when necessary.

Conservative care includes rest during acute flare-ups, physical therapy to strengthen core muscles and improve flexibility, and anti-inflammatory medications to reduce nerve irritation. Most Dallas patients find significant relief within several weeks of conservative treatment.

Interventional procedures like epidural steroid injections deliver anti-inflammatory medication directly to the affected nerve root. These injections can provide relief for many patients with radiculopathy approximately 50-75% of patients, though benefits may be temporary and repeat injections are sometimes needed.

Minimally invasive surgery becomes an option when conservative treatment fails to provide adequate relief after 6-12 weeks, or when patients experience progressive neurological deficits. Modern techniques offer faster recovery and less tissue trauma than traditional open surgery.

Conservative Treatment Approaches

Before considering surgical intervention, several conservative approaches should be explored:

  • Rest and activity modification during acute phases help avoid movements that worsen nerve compression
  • Physical therapy focusing on core strengthening and flexibility has demonstrated effectiveness in reducing sciatic pain
  • Anti-inflammatory medications including NSAIDs reduce inflammation around the affected nerve root, providing symptom relief in many cases
  • Heat and cold therapy can provide temporary pain relief and reduce muscle spasm
  • Epidural steroid injections for persistent symptoms that don’t respond to simpler measures
  • Chiropractic or osteopathic manipulation may help some patients, though should be approached cautiously with significant disc herniations

Minimally Invasive and Surgical Options

When conservative treatment doesn’t provide adequate relief, or when neurological deficits progress, surgical intervention may be recommended. Modern minimally invasive techniques offer significant advantages over traditional open surgery.

Microdiscectomy removes herniated disc material compressing the nerve root. This procedure has success rates of 85-90% in providing symptom relief.

Laminotomy or laminectomy relieves compression from spinal stenosis by removing bone that’s narrowing the nerve canal. Patients undergoing minimally invasive laminotomy typically experience significant reductions in operative time, blood loss, and hospital stay approximately 40-50% compared to traditional open decompression.

Foraminotomy enlarges the opening where nerve roots exit the spine, relieving foraminal stenosis without requiring extensive bone removal.

When to See a Spine Specialist in Dallas

While mild back and leg pain often resolves on its own, certain warning signs indicate you should seek specialist evaluation sooner rather than later:

  • Persistent pain lasting more than 4-6 weeks despite conservative self-care measures
  • Progressive numbness, weakness, or loss of function in your leg or foot
  • Severe pain that significantly affects your daily activities, work, or sleep quality
  • Bowel or bladder dysfunction including loss of control or new-onset incontinence—this constitutes a surgical emergency called cauda equina syndrome
  • Failure to improve with conservative treatment after a reasonable trial period
